Tennessee experiences hot, humid summers and significant rainfall, which can degrade traditional roofing materials and lead to moisture issues. The state is also prone to severe thunderstorms and occasional hail. Our metal roofing systems provide superior resistance to heat, moisture, wind, and impact, ensuring long-term protection and energy efficiency. What is the 25% rule for roofing?

The 25% rule typically applies to asphalt shingles, suggesting replacement if a significant portion is damaged. Metal roofing systems offer more flexibility in repair strategies. We evaluate your roof's condition to recommend the most appropriate and economical solution for your property.

What are the best roof shingle types for Tennessee?

For Tennessee's hot, humid climate and potential for severe storms, durable metal shingle types are highly recommended. Options like standing seam or metal tiles offer excellent resistance to heat, moisture, and impact. They provide superior longevity and energy efficiency compared to traditional shingles.
